Mindfulness in the business world is moving from the fringe to the mainstream and now features as part of many leadership and management programmes. This open-access course is for business leaders and offers the opportunity to develop mindful practices and techniques in a time-effective format.

The course will give participants a deeper understanding of their own patterns of behaviour; will help people develop stress-reduction strategies; and improve creativity – all essential for meeting current workplace and leadership challenges.

Mindfulness is a way of training your mind to be where you want it to be. “It’s like push ups for the brain” said one US Marine. “Mindfulness helps put a Spam filter in your head” says Dr Danny Penman.

Ancient wisdom, psychological research and modern neuroscience are combining powerfully to demonstrate the benefits of mindfulness for leaders at work. By incorporating mindfulness practices into your daily life you can experience:

  • Better health and well being
  • Clearer thinking
  • Enhanced communication
  • Improved leadership skills
  • Greater Emotional Intelligence (EQ)
  • Meaningful relationships at work and outside
  • More awareness of personal stress and how to manage it
